Pay your tuition fees at ASOIU by instalment via BirKart

Kapital Bank, which supports the development of education in the country, introduced another innovation to its customers. The campaign is applied to BirKart owners, their children or loved ones studying at the Azerbaijan State Oil and Industry University (ASOIU).
 
Within the framework of the campaign, until October 10, 2019, students studying on a paid basis at the Azerbaijan State Oil and Industry University, can pay tuition fees in twelve equal installments (equal parts). No additional charges will be made on the amount paid. For that, an annual tuition fee must be paid via BirKart in the university through Kapital Bank’s POS terminal.
 
The BirKart card is presented in three types — BirKart (classic installment card), BirKart Cashback (installment card/cashback) and BirKart Miles (installment/miles). BirKart has a number of advantages, such as: obtaining an installment up to 18 months, up to 40 days of interest-free loan in case of one-time payment, withdrawing the entire amount in cash and possibility to receive from 1,5% to 30% of cashback when paying for products and services. SMS notification service is provided free.
